If a picture’s worth a thousand words, then we’ll let the above do all the talking. Master colorist Henri Matisse. His famous and revolutionary cut-outs — cut and painted sheets that he collaged into compositions, some full room-sized. On view at New York’s Museum of Modern Art till February 8. A must-see.
